"""Test for volume availability zone."""
import datetime
import mock
from oslo_utils import timeutils
from cinder.tests.unit import volume as base
import cinder.volume
class AvailabilityZoneTestCase(base.BaseVolumeTestCase):
def setUp(self):
super(AvailabilityZoneTestCase, self).setUp()
self.get_all = self.patch(
'cinder.db.service_get_all', autospec=True,
return_value = [{'availability_zone': 'a', 'disabled': False}])
def test_list_availability_zones_cached(self):
azs = self.volume_api.list_availability_zones(enable_cache=True)
self.assertEqual([{"name": 'a', 'available': True}], list(azs))
self.assertIsNotNone(self.volume_api.availability_zones_last_fetched)
self.assertTrue(self.get_all.called)
self.volume_api.list_availability_zones(enable_cache=True)
self.assertEqual(1, self.get_all.call_count)
def test_list_availability_zones_no_cached(self):
azs = self.volume_api.list_availability_zones(enable_cache=False)
self.assertEqual([{"name": 'a', 'available': True}], list(azs))
self.assertIsNone(self.volume_api.availability_zones_last_fetched)
self.get_all.return_value[0]['disabled'] = True
azs = self.volume_api.list_availability_zones(enable_cache=False)
self.assertEqual([{"name": 'a', 'available': False}], list(azs))
self.assertIsNone(self.volume_api.availability_zones_last_fetched)
@mock.patch('oslo_utils.timeutils.utcnow')
def test_list_availability_zones_refetched(self, mock_utcnow):
mock_utcnow.return_value = datetime.datetime.utcnow()
azs = self.volume_api.list_availability_zones(enable_cache=True)
self.assertEqual([{"name": 'a', 'available': True}], list(azs))
self.assertIsNotNone(self.volume_api.availability_zones_last_fetched)
last_fetched = self.volume_api.availability_zones_last_fetched
self.assertTrue(self.get_all.called)
self.volume_api.list_availability_zones(enable_cache=True)
self.assertEqual(1, self.get_all.call_count)
# The default cache time is 3600, push past that...
mock_utcnow.return_value = (timeutils.utcnow() +
datetime.timedelta(0, 3800))
self.get_all.return_value = [
{
'availability_zone': 'a',
'disabled': False,
},
{
'availability_zone': 'b',
'disabled': False,
},
]
azs = self.volume_api.list_availability_zones(enable_cache=True)
azs = sorted([n['name'] for n in azs])
self.assertEqual(['a', 'b'], azs)
self.assertEqual(2, self.get_all.call_count)
self.assertGreater(self.volume_api.availability_zones_last_fetched,
last_fetched)
mock_utcnow.assert_called_with()
def test_list_availability_zones_enabled_service(self):
def sort_func(obj):
return obj['name']
self.get_all.return_value = [
{'availability_zone': 'ping', 'disabled': 0},
{'availability_zone': 'ping', 'disabled': 1},
{'availability_zone': 'pong', 'disabled': 0},
{'availability_zone': 'pung', 'disabled': 1},
]
volume_api = cinder.volume.api.API()
azs = volume_api.list_availability_zones()
azs = sorted(azs, key=sort_func)
expected = sorted([
{'name': 'pung', 'available': False},
{'name': 'pong', 'available': True},
{'name': 'ping', 'available': True},
], key=sort_func)
self.assertEqual(expected, azs)

"""Tests for volume policy."""
import mock
from cinder import context
from cinder import test
import cinder.policy
class VolumePolicyTestCase(test.TestCase):
def setUp(self):
super(VolumePolicyTestCase, self).setUp()
cinder.policy.init()
self.context = context.get_admin_context()
def test_check_policy(self):
target = {
'project_id': self.context.project_id,
'user_id': self.context.user_id,
}
with mock.patch.object(cinder.policy, 'enforce') as mock_enforce:
cinder.volume.api.check_policy(self.context, 'attach')
mock_enforce.assert_called_once_with(self.context,
'volume:attach',
target)
def test_check_policy_with_target(self):
target = {
'project_id': self.context.project_id,
'user_id': self.context.user_id,
'id': 2,
}
with mock.patch.object(cinder.policy, 'enforce') as mock_enforce:
cinder.volume.api.check_policy(self.context, 'attach', {'id': 2})
mock_enforce.assert_called_once_with(self.context,
'volume:attach',
target)
